Top 5 Boxing Games on iOS in South America for Q3 2024
Discover the performance trends of the leading boxing games on iOS in South America during Q3 2024, with data insights from Sensor Tower.
In the third quarter of 2024, the boxing games category on iOS in South America showcased a dynamic range of performance trends. Here's a closer look at the top five leading apps, with data insights provided by Sensor Tower.
Boxing Star: Real Boxing Fight from THUMBAGE experienced fluctuations in weekly revenue, starting at approximately $480 and closing the quarter around $350. Downloads saw a peak of 806 in early September before settling at 241 by the end of the quarter. Active users followed a similar pattern, peaking at 2.6K and ending with 1.4K.
Real Boxing 2 by Vivid Games S.A. showed a varied trend in downloads, with a significant high of 4.6K in late July and a low of 1.1K at the end of September. Weekly revenue saw modest fluctuations, reaching a maximum of $326 in early August. Active users saw a decline from 5.2K to 2.7K over the quarter.
Kongregate's Burrito Bison: Launcha Libre maintained a steady performance with weekly revenue mostly below $200, peaking at $202 at the start of the quarter. Downloads remained relatively low, with a small peak of 101 in late August. Active users hovered around the 400 mark, showing minor fluctuations throughout the quarter.
EA SPORTS™ UFC® 2 from Electronic Arts demonstrated a notable surge in downloads, peaking at 8.2K in early September. Revenue fluctuated modestly, with a high of $197 mid-September. Active users increased significantly to 22.1K in early September, before declining to 11.8K by quarter's end.
Finally, MMA Manager 2: Ultimate Fight from Prey Studios saw its highest revenue at $226 in early July. Downloads peaked at 434 in early September, with active users peaking at 905 mid-September before decreasing to 491.
